9 Castlepark, Carrick-on-suir, Co Tipperary
Construction of a single-storey rear extension and retention of front bay windows.

Development description
A new single storey bedroom and shower room extension to the rear of our bungalow residence and all associated site works and planning permission retention for bay windows as constructed to the front of our bungalow residence
